Oikos is the international student organisation for sustainable economics and management. Oikos International is the umbrella organisation which supports and leads the student network of 36 Chapters in 20 countries across the world. Each Chapter is driven by highly motivated students (and their University) who push for change towards sustainability in economics through events and projects at their universities.

Oikos also has an academic arm, the oikos Foundation, which aims to integrate social and economic dimensions into the teaching and research of economics and business administration through a PhD Fellowship programme, week-long PhD academies, and support for sustainability teaching.
